Service Point Introduces Custom Branded Digital Storefront Sites for Clients

Woburn, MA, (01-29-2010) – Service Point USA announces it is now offering hosted, custom-branded Digital Storefront (DSF) sites for clients. Also known as Web-to-Print Storefronts, custom branded DSF sites provide users with online access to a catalog of personalized and/or unique, client-specific documents to select from and automate print orders. Sites are graphically branded with a client’s logo and may be used for intercompany or external, commercial applications. Online printing from user-created desktop files is also supported.

Digital Storefronts provide a complete, streamlined workflow from the user through print production, to finishing and delivery or distribution of printed documents. Catalog documents may typically include marketing materials, stationery and business card templates for intercompany sites, or product guides, reference manuals, and other such documents for customer-facing sites. Digital files for these items are easily updated and replaced so that a company’s DSF site remains current at all times.

DSF features include Variable Data Printing (VDP) for applications such as business card orders from branded templates; optional PDF conversion of files, online proofing, order status reporting, and order history for reporting purposes or re-orders. The Shopping Cart feature enables payment for orders by credit card or invoicing via Service Point account.

DSF provides enhanced efficiency in both the print order process and in utilizing Service Point’s complete printing and distribution services. These services include finishing and kitting with variable components for product support materials such as guides and reference manuals, small document printing for other needs, and large format display and event graphics.

Service Point’s own Digital Storefront for customers, the The Print Store, illustrates a commercial use of DSF. Any potential user can register for a login and select specific types and quantities of items to print, or choose their own specifications, and upload their file(s).

For custom client sites, many template variations in appearance and structure, including variable categories of products, are available. Service Point works with each of its clients requesting custom DSF sites to select components suitable to their needs.

Service Point’s Digital Storefronts are powered by EFI, which enables more than 3,000 printing sites worldwide. Technical support for DSF clients is provided directly by Service Point’s IT group.

Benefits to clients with custom Digital Storefronts include: a self-serve site with increased efficiency and speed in placement of print orders by users without the need for assistance by company personnel, brand awareness and compliance by users to their company’s standards, and increased accountability and control of print materials and users.

About Service Point
Service Point provides tools and services for greater efficiency in document, print, and information management via networked service centers, online, and through On-Site Services programs with client firms nationwide.

Service Point USA is a subsidiary of Service Point Solutions. It employs over 2,700 people across 8 countries through a network of 140 services centers and 840 facilities management programs. SPS is headquartered in Spain and listed on the Madrid and Barcelona stock exchanges (ticker: SPS.MC).
